How do natural disasters impact ecosystems?

Natural disasters can have a significant impact on ecosystems. They can cause habitat destruction, loss of biodiversity, disruption of food chains, water pollution, soil erosion, and changes in landscape structure. These events can also lead to the displacement or extinction of certain species, as well as alterations in ecosystem dynamics and functions. Overall, natural disasters can have long-lasting and sometimes irreversible effects on ecosystems.
